Triumph Bancorp (TBK) Tops Q3 EPS by 3c, Beat on Revenues

October 18, 2017 4:22 PM EDT

Triumph Bancorp (NASDAQ: TBK) reported Q3 EPS of $0.47, $0.03 better than the analyst estimate of $0.44. Revenue for the quarter came in at $45.14 million versus the consensus estimate of $44.54 million.

2017 Third Quarter Highlights

  • For the third quarter of 2017, net income was $9.8 million and net income available to common stockholders was $9.6 million, compared to net income of $9.7 million and net income available to common stockholders of $9.5 million for the quarter ended June 30, 2017.
  • Diluted earnings per share were $0.47 for the quarter ended September 30, 2017, compared to $0.51 for the quarter ended June 30, 2017. Earnings per share were impacted by our public offering of 2.53 million shares of our common stock on August 1, 2017. Our net proceeds from the offering, after deducting the underwriting discount and offering expenses, were $65.5 million.
  • Total loans held for investment increased $130.4 million, or 5.7%, to $2.425 billion at September 30, 2017, compared to $2.295 billion at June 30, 2017.
  • Non-performing assets to total assets decreased to 1.42% at September 30, 2017 from 1.50% at June 30, 2017. Net charge-offs to average loans decreased to 0.00% for the quarter ended September 30, 2017, compared to 0.03% for the quarter ended June 30, 2017.
  • Net interest margin (“NIM”) was 5.90% for the quarter ended September 30, 2017, compared to 6.16% for the quarter ended June 30, 2017. Adjusted NIM, which excludes loan discount accretion, was 5.69% for the quarter ended September 30, 2017, compared to 5.70% for the quarter ended June 30, 2017.
